Window remodeling services involve upgrading or replacing existing windows to improve the app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ency of a property. This process can include installing new window frames, upgrading to more modern or energy-efficient glass, or customizing window styles to better match the home's design. Homeowners may choose window remodeling to enhance curb appeal, increase natural light, or address issues with outdated or damaged windows. Skilled contractors can handle a variety of window styles, including casement, double-hung, sliding, or picture windows, ensuring the finished result meets both aesthetic and practical needs.
Many problems prompt homeowners to seek window remodeling services. Common issues include drafts or air leaks that lead to higher energy bills, difficulty opening or closing windows, or visible damage such as cracks, warping, or rot. Over time, windows can become less effective at insulating a home, making rooms uncomfortable and increasing heating or cooling costs. Additionally, older windows may no longer meet safety standards or may be incompatible with modern window treatments. Remodeling provides an opportunity to resolve these problems by replacing or upgrading windows with more durable, secure, and energy-efficient options.

The overview below groups typical Window Remodeling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Eatontown,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s such as replacing broken glass or seals generally range from $100 to $300.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the window size and type.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this band, which covers more involved repairs.
Partial Window Replacement - Replacing individual windows or sash components usually costs between $250 and $600 per window. Many projects in Eatontown and nearby areas fall into this middle range, with larger or more complex replacements reaching higher costs.
Full Window Replacement - Complete replacement of standard windows typically costs from $1,000 to $3,000 per window, including installation. Larger, more elaborate projects or custom window types can exceed $4,000, though such cases are less common.
Whole-Home Remodeling - Whole-house window remodeling or extensive upgrades can range from $10,000 to $50,000 or more, depending on the number of windows and scope of work. Most projects in this category fall in the middle to upper tiers, with very large or luxury homes reaching the highest cost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
